Well, everyone knows how popular VW Polos are in South Africa. Now with the Polo sedan on the market, there is more to enjoy and relax in spacious comfort on that long journey.

The sedan offers a reliable 1.6-litre MPI engine that delivers 81kw of power, confidently taking you from point A to B and even a ‘sho’t left’.

It now boasts a new bumper and grille design that stretches across the front, with Eco LED headlamps to help maintain caution during night drives, and at the back, the LED tail lights complete its sensible charm.

The Polo sedan is fitted with convenient parking technologies such as a rearview camera system, rear park distance control and hill start assist.

It comes in three derivatives, the 1.6 MPI manual, 1.6 MPI tiptronic and 1.6 MPI life manual.
There’s ample space, starting with its impressive boot capacity of 521 litres, all the way down to its 2.65m wheelbase and its length of 4.56m which offers more than enough room. Enjoy plenty of storage space with glove compartments and pockets in the rear of the front seats.
